Feature Requests / Idea of Quality Improvement
« on: September 12, 2012, 03:32:04 PM »
Hello!

Just read that thread:
http://www.agisoft.ru/forum/index.php?topic=677.0

The quality of the smooth reconstruction method could be improved if PhotoScan would only place polygons near to a point of the pointcloud. The distance should be defined the user.

If PhotoScan was able to calculate the density of every point inside the pointcloud there could be a second user defined variable to produce only polygons near to specific density of the pointcloud.

For that method it would be nice that the user could place or duplicate&move extra-points just to be sure that there will be no holes. As an automatic method it should be easy to convert fast generated Lowest/Low/Mid-Poly-Meshes into ("extra-") point-clouds.

Positive: Better geometry-quality - few less polys but much more space on the UV (increased texture-quality).
Negative: That method could create some holes (no watertight mesh).

I hope you like this idea of quality-improvement.
It?s a little bit like masking in the third dimension.
Hope to get feedback from Alexey or other PhotoScan-users.

Feature Requests / Handling Subdivided Objects
« on: September 12, 2012, 02:46:44 PM »
Hello!

It would be very nice if PhotoScan could handle objects with subdivision (and a displacement-map on it):

1. Generate a Hi-Poly-Mesh inside PhotoScan
2. Retopologize that and create an UV with a software of your choice and reproject the details out to a displacement-map. (If PhotoScan could produce displacement-maps by itself out of one Hi-Poly-Mesh and one Low-Poly-Mesh it would be even better!)
3. Import that mesh into PhotoScan
4. Build texture on the displaced Retopo

That would speed up the overall-workflow, the texture-quality will increase, the output-datavolume will decrease and it would be helpful for PsPro-users (for animation). Maybe it?s even a good way for generating larger arealmaps (I think it?s equal to DEM-maps).
